#define GOLDEN_SIZE 0.381966011250105 // 1 / (1 + phi); phi = (sqrt(5) + 1) / 2
|
|
|
|
namespace Lancelot
|
|
{
|
|
|
|
class GoldenColumnSizer: public ColumnLayout::ColumnSizer {
|
|
public:
|
|
void init(int count) {
|
|
m_position = 0;
|
|
qreal size = 1.0;
|
|
m_sizes.clear();
|
|
while (count) {
|
|
if (count == 1) {
|
|
m_sizes.prepend(size);
|
|
} else if (count == 2) {
|
|
m_sizes.prepend((1 - GOLDEN_SIZE) * size);
|
|
size *= GOLDEN_SIZE;
|
|
} else {
|
|
m_sizes.prepend(size * GOLDEN_SIZE);
|
|
size -= size * GOLDEN_SIZE;
|
|
}
|
|
--count;
|
|
}
|
|
}
|
|
|
|
qreal size() {
|
|
if (m_position < 0 || m_position > m_sizes.size()) return 0;
|
|
return m_sizes.at(m_position++);
|
|
}
|
|
private:
|
|
QList < qreal > m_sizes;
|
|
int m_position;
|
|
};
|
|
|
|
class EqualColumnSizer: public ColumnLayout::ColumnSizer {
|
|
public:
|
|
void init(int count) {
|
|
m_count = count;
|
|
}
|
|
|
|
qreal size() {
|
|
return 1.0 / m_count;
|
|
}
|
|
private:
|
|
int m_count;
|
|
};
|
|
|
|
ColumnLayout::ColumnSizer::~ColumnSizer()
|
|
{
|
|
}
|
|
|
|
ColumnLayout::ColumnSizer * ColumnLayout::ColumnSizer::create(SizerType type)
|
|
{
|
|
switch (type) {
|
|
case EqualSizer:
|
|
return new EqualColumnSizer();
|
|
case GoldenSizer:
|
|
return new GoldenColumnSizer();
|
|
}
|
|
return NULL;
|
|
}
